Output 358766a266fe390d655551c6e1f4ca301531bd737cbafc0c0a4d9fa61454ba88:25

value
380545
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53ef57c333524d2582b722ae68ce9cf317cb6fa1 OP_EQUALVERIFY OP_CHECKSIG
address
18eookfGu5FUjtXQ9rS5kZJkJWLwh12HBF
transaction
358766a266fe390d655551c6e1f4ca301531bd737cbafc0c0a4d9fa61454ba88